What is an Oil-Free Screw Air Compressor?

An oil-free screw air compressor is a device that uses two intermeshing helical screws (also known as rotors) to compress air without the introduction of oil. These systems are designed to be environmentally friendly and ideal for applications where air purity is paramount.

How Does an Oil-Free Screw Air Compressor Work?

The operation of an oil-free screw air compressor is based on a simple yet efficient process. The air is drawn into the compressor through an inlet valve and then compressed by the rotating gears of the screws.

Applications and Uses

Ms. Sarah Rogers, a consultant specializing in compressed air systems, shares that "Oil-free screw compressors are particularly vital in industries such as food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, and electronics, where even the slightest contamination could lead to product spoilage." This highlights the necessity of using oil-free technology in critical applications.
